I just want to take this blog to say thank you to everyone who remembers Elijah.

Today we got a package from a family member and it was full of awesome Batman gifts. (Batman is one of our signs for Elijah).

But what really meant the most to me, is that there were 4 little heart shaped boxes of chocolates for Valentine's Day and each one of them had a name written on it. One for Alex. One for Julien. One for Gabriel. And one for Elijah.

Now, I know that Elijah will never hold this box of chocolates or ever eat them, but he is still my son and it means the world to me when he is still included.

I keep all his Christmas cards, Birthday cards, little gifts and little treasures on a shelf. And when I look at them and know that he is not forgotten it makes the pain of him being "gone" a little less lighter.

Death never changed the fact that he is my son.

So thank you to all of you who remember him through acts of kindness, cards or presents, or commenting or liking photos of him on my social media-- because you are what keeps a little piece of him "alive" for me.
